1.
Input Tray—Holds the documents in the Automatic Document Feeder for scanning.
Extension—Pull out to support various document lengths.
l
Paper Guides—Slide to adjust to document width.
l
2.
Automatic Document Feeder—Feeds documents through the scanner during scanning.
ADF Cover Release—Press to open the Automatic Document Feeder.
l
3.
Control Panel—OneTouch scanning controls.
l
LCD Screen—Shows the current scan settings.
l
Up/Down Buttons—Press to change the number on the LCD screen indicating the scan-to destination.
l
Power Button—Press to turn on the power.
l
Simplex Button—Press to scan single-sided documents.
l
Duplex Button—Press to scan double-sided documents.
4.
Output Tray—Holds documents after being scanned.
l
Paper Stop (Short Documents)—Flip up to keep short items stacked neatly in the output tray after
scanning. Slide to adjust to the length of the scanned documents.
Extension—Flip out to support various document lengths.
l
Paper Stop (Regular Documents)—Flip up to keep regular documents stacked neatly in the output tray
l
after scanning.
5.
Connections—Scanner connection ports.
Power Jack—Connect the power cord to the scanner.
l
Universal Serial Bus (USB 3.1 Gen 1) Port—Connect the scanner to the computer via the USB 3.1 Gen 1
l
cable.
